The U.S. News and World Report Rankings

Each year, U.S. News evaluates a staggering 899 hospitals across the nation, rigorously assessing their capabilities in treating a wide array of medical conditions, including cancers such as leukemia, lymphoma, melanoma, breast, kidney, colon, prostate, pancreatic, head and neck, orthopedic, uterine, and ovarian cancers. Out of this extensive evaluation, the report ranks the top 50 hospitals that excel in providing cancer care, and New York has made an impressive mark on this list.


Specialty Rankings vs. Procedure and Condition Ratings

To truly understand the significance of these rankings, it's essential to differentiate between specialty rankings and procedure and condition ratings. The Best Hospitals specialty rankings are tailor-made for patients with life-threatening or rare conditions who require treatment at a facility that excels in handling complex and high-risk cases. These rankings are particularly valuable if you are dealing with a rare condition or a challenging diagnosis that demands specialized care.


New York's Top Cancer Hospitals

Let's take a closer look at the cancer specialty rankings of the top hospitals in New York:

  •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center: Renowned worldwide,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(MSK) has consistently secured a top spot in the rankings. It is a pioneer in cancer research and treatment, offering a comprehensive range of services. Patients benefit from access to cutting-edge clinical trials, innovative therapies, and a multidisciplinary team of experts. According to MSK, "the people of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(MSK) are united by a singular mission: ending cancer for life. Our specialized care teams provide personalized, compassionate, expert care to patients of all ages. Informed by basic research done at our Sloan Kettering Institute, scientists across MSK collaborate to conduct innovative translational and clinical research that is driving a revolution in our understanding of cancer as a disease and improving the ability to prevent, diagnose, and treat it. MSK is dedicated to training the next generation of scientists and clinicians, who go on to pursue our mission at MSK and around the globe. One of the world’s most respected comprehensive centers devoted exclusively to cancer, we have been recognized as one of the top two cancer hospitals in the country by U.S. News & World Report for more than 30 years."


  • Mount Sinai Hospital Tisch Cancer Center: Mount Sinai Hospital is another New York institution that excels in cancer care. It is known for its patient-centered approach, advanced technology, and a strong focus on personalized treatment plans. Mount Sinai's cancer department covers a wide range of specialties, ensuring that patients receive the most suitable and effective care. According to Mount Sinai Tisch Cancer Center, The "care team is committed to providing the highest-quality cancer care available using a comprehensive range of diagnostic, therapeutic, and support services. We have one of the top cancer programs in the United States, as ranked by U.S. News & World Report Best Hospitals survey. Because our physicians and faculty are actively involved in cancer research at The Tisch Cancer Institute, a National Cancer Institute-Designated Cancer Center, we can provide patients access to clinical breakthroughs, leading-edge technologies, and the safest, most effective treatment options.


  • New York-Presbyterian Hospital of Columbia and Cornell: This esteemed hospital combines the resources of two Ivy League medical institutions, Weill Cornell Medicine and Columbia University Vagelos College of Physicians and Surgeons. It boasts a robust cancer department that offers comprehensive care, from diagnosis to treatment and beyond. Patients benefit from the hospital's collaborative research efforts, which drive advancements in cancer care. According to New York-Presbyterian, "our oncologists, surgeons, gastroenterologists, radiologists, and pathologists are recognized leaders in many areas of cancer research, treatment, and care for even the most complex of cases. Our team includes oncologists and other cancer specialists from our top-ranked academic medical centers. As a patient at NewYork-Presbyterian, you can expect a diverse team of experts, equipped with the latest cancer research and treatments, dedicated to providing you with high-quality, compassionate care.
